Job Description

The Cathedral of Mary Our Queen in Baltimore, Maryland is seeking a qualified, part-time Communications Coordinator The Communications Coordinator will support the Cathedral's mission of proclaiming the love of Jesus Christ and upholding the Church's traditions of worship, teaching, and charity. The Communications Coordinator oversees communications activities, with a primary focus on producing the Cathedral's weekly communications through print materials and digital platforms. This individual coordinates social media content based on ideas contributed by parish leadership. In addition, the coordinator manages and edits the Cathedral’s website and maintains its social media accounts. This position will work 8 - 12 hours per week.

Essential Functions

  • Maintain the parish website with continuous updates to keep the community informed and engaged.
  • Prepare and publish various communications, such as Flocknotes publications, newsletters, weekly bulletin, etc.
  • Produce publications for ministry and evangelization purposes, such as new parishioner welcome packets, sacrament preparation materials, etc.
  • Maintain and update various social media platforms, such as Facebook and Instagram

Position Qualifications

  • High School diploma or equivalent.
  • Proficiency with social media platforms.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ft and Google software tools.
  • Experience with website design and/or graphic design is preferred.
  • Knowledge of the Catholic Church structure and traditions is preferred.

Range: $18.00, Hourly

Benefits:

We offer a generous paid sick leave benefit with this position, and employee automatic enrollment in the 403(b) plan.

About Archdiocese of Baltimore

The Archdiocese of Baltimore, established as a diocese in 1789, comprises the City of Baltimore and Allegany, Anne Arundel, Baltimore, Carroll, Frederick, Garrett, Harford, Howard and Washington Counties.

God calls the Catholics of the Archdiocese of Baltimore to be a welcoming, worshipping community of faith, hope, and love. Through his Spirit, the Lord Jesus lives in those who believe, and reaches into our world with his saving message and healing love.

As disciples of Jesus our mission is:

Evangelization - to evangelize ourselves, our families, our parish and local communities, and our world.

Liturgy - to celebrate our faith with joy through vibrant and prayerful worship.

Education - to educate and become educated in the truths of the Gospel and in the formation of conscience.

Service - to reach out in love and service to those in need.

Stewardship - to develop the material, financial and human resources of the Church and to manage them as faithful stewards.

The Catholic Center is located at 320 Cathedral Street, Baltimore, MD 21201.
